In division one, championship winner Eaglehawk hosts Shepparton United with the winner to advance to the grand final and the loser to host next week’s preliminary final.
While Eaglehawk finished above Shepparton United on the division one ladder, the Hawks haven’t beaten United this season.
The round one clash at Truscott Reserve finished in a 2-2 draw, while in round 12 Shepparton United scored a 2-0 victory at home.
Since that game the Hawks have added Alex Caldow to their squad after the attacking midfielder quit Epsom late in the season.
United enters the game on the back of six-straight wins. Eaglehawk and Shepparton United have the stingiest defences in the competition, so it might only take one goal to win the game or it could go the distance to a penalty shootout.
Third-placed Shepparton South hosts fourth-placed Strathdale in Sunday’s elimination semi-final.
Shepparton South will start a warm favourite on its home deck at McEwen Reserve.
South has only lost one of its past nine matches which was a 1-0 defeat to Eaglehawk.
The Blues’ best form is clearly good enough, but they have been inconsistent in the latter stages of the season.
Shepparton United should win the women’s second semi-final.
United only dropped one match through the home and away season.
Strathdale and Colts play in the women’s first semi-final just two weeks after the Blues thumped Colts 4-1 in the final home and away round.
The semi-final brings together the two top players in the women’s league best and fairest award – Strathdale’s Ellie Vlaeminck and Colts’ Rebecca Berry.
